One cannot discuss the transgender community without addressing the brutal realities of systemic violence. According to the Human Rights Campaign, 2021 and 2022 were the deadliest years on record for trans people in the United States, with the vast majority of victims being Black and Latinx trans women.

For years, their contributions were minimized or erased by mainstream, assimilationist gay and lesbian groups who felt that "respectable" society would be more accepting if they distanced themselves from the "unruly" drag queens and trans sex workers. Rivera’s famous speech at a 1973 gay pride rally in New York, where she was booed for demanding that the movement not abandon trans people and drag queens, remains a haunting reminder of the internal tensions that have always existed.
